The Hyundai Motor Group Experiential Science Museum was developed as part of a major mixed-use campus in Seoul, South Korea, in collaboration with Foster + Partners. As Senior 3D Designer, I led the planning and development of one of the museum’s primary educational galleries, designed workshop and teaching environments for hands-on public programming, and adapted approximately 50 interactive exhibits into a unified design language. Working closely with engineers, project managers, production teams, and graphic designers, I developed design packages, material palettes, and client presentations that supported quarterly design reviews throughout the project’s development.​​​​​​​
